Tweaking to Perfection

Substituting with Ease

The real beauty of these bars lies in their adaptability. Vegan? Use dairy-free chocolate. Gluten-free? Opt for gluten-free oats. Nut allergy? Seeds like sunflower or pumpkin can step in to provide that crucial crunch. The possibilities are endless, allowing you to tailor the recipe to your dietary needs and preferences.

Flavor Variations

Not a fan of almonds? Try walnuts or pecans. Want to add a different kind of sweetness? A sprinkle of dried cranberries or a dash of cinnamon can transform the flavor profile. Experimenting with various ingredients not only customizes the bars to your liking but also keeps the excitement alive each time you make them.

Storing for Freshness

Once made, these bars store beautifully. In the fridge, they’ll keep for a week, always ready for a grab-and-go moment. But here’s the best part – they freeze exceptionally well. Wrap them individually and pop them into the freezer, and you’ve got a month’s supply of instant snacks.

Thawing Tips

Need a quick bite? Just take a bar out of the freezer. They thaw fairly quickly at room temperature, but if you’re in a hurry, a few seconds in the microwave, and you’re good to go. The texture remains just as delightful, and the taste as fresh as the day you made them.

Vegan Chocolate Covered Date Crunch Bars

Prep Time20 minutes
Freeze Time45 minutes
Total Time1 hour 5 minutes

Servings: 10 servings
Calories: 230kcal

Ingredients

  • 1 cup pitted dates
  • 1/2 cup rolled oats
  • 1/4 cup almonds roughly chopped
  • 1/4 cup pumpkin seeds
  • 2 tablespoons chia seeds
  • 1/2 cup unsweetened shredded coconut
  • 1/4 cup almond but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 teaspoon sea salt
  • 200 grams dark vegan chocolate at least 70% cocoa

Instructions

Soak Dates:

  • Soak the dates in warm water for 10 minutes to soften them.

Process Dates:

  • Drain the dates and process them in a food processor until they form a sticky paste.

Mix Dry Ingredients:

  • In a large bowl, mix the oats, almonds, pumpkin seeds, chia seeds, and shredded coconut.

Combine:

  • Add the date paste, almond butter, vanilla extract, and sea salt to the dry ingredients. Mix well until everything is combined and sticks together.

Shape Bars:

  • Press the mixture into a lined baking tray, forming an even layer. Freeze for about 30 minutes.

Melt Chocolate:

  • Melt the vegan chocolate in a double boiler or microwave.

Coat Bars:

  • Remove the hardened mixture from the freezer and cut into bars. Dip each bar into the melted chocolate, ensuring it's fully coated.

Set:

  • Place the chocolate-coated bars on a parchment-lined tray and freeze for another 15-20 minutes until the chocolate sets.
